On Thu, Dec 16, 2010 at 8:16 AM, Dave Wright<wrig...@gmail.com>
wrote:
My recommendation would actually be a combination of the two which
offers the most flexibility:

zoo_multi_test_and_set(List<string>  znodesToTest, List<int>  versions,
List<string>  znodesToSet, List<byte[]>  data)

...this specifies a list of nodes&  versions to check, and if the
versions match, a list of nodes to set and the associated data.
This allows multiple scenarios, including setting nodes other than the
ones you are version checking, setting more nodes than you version
check, checking more nodes than you set, etc.
I don't think the implementation would be any harder than either of
the
others.

On Tue, Dec 14, 2010 at 11:21 PM, Qian Ye<yeqian....@gmail.com>
wrote:
zoo_multi_test_and_set(List<int>  versions, List<string>  znodes,
List<byte[]>  data)

can solve the problem I mentioned before, and some relavant issues,
like
hard for programmers to use, as mentioned in mail-archive, should
be
paid
attention to. I think we can move small step first, that is,
provide
interface like

zoo_multi_test_and_set(List<int>  versions, List<string>  znodes,
byte[]
data, string znode)


The API test versions of several different znodes before set one
znode,
and
if the client want to set other znode, it can call this API
repeatedly.
Because we only set one node by this API, the result will be
straight,
success or failure. We need not take care of the half-success
result.
How do ur guys think about this API?
